Це команда cg3, яку можна запустити в постачальнику безкоштовного хостингу OnWorks за допомогою однієї з наших численних безкоштовних робочих станцій, таких як Ubuntu Online, Fedora Online, онлайн-емулятор Windows або онлайн-емулятор MAC OS
ПРОГРАМА:
ІМ'Я
vislcg3 - Ця програма є частиною ( cg3 )
Цей інструмент є частиною граматичної системи обмежень CG-3: http://visl.sdu.dk/cg3.html.
СИНТАКСИС
vislcg3 [ПАРАЦІЇ]
ОПИС
vislcg3 є синтаксичним аналізатором граматики та визначником у системі граматики обмежень VISL. Це
вибирає між різними аналізами (або "читаннями") слова, переданого морфологічним
аналізатор на основі набору граматичних правил.
За замовчуванням vislcg3 читає вхідні дані зі стандартного вводу і записує вихідні дані в стандартний вихід.
ВАРІАНТИ
-h, --допомога
показує цю допомогу
-?, --?
показує цю допомогу
-V, -- версія
друкує інформацію про авторські права та версію
-g, --граматика
визначає файл граматики, який буде використовуватися для тлумачення
--граматичний вихід
записує скомпільовану граматику у текстовій формі у файл
--grammar-bin
записує скомпільовану граматику у двійковій формі у файл
--лише граматика
тільки компілює граматику; має на увазі -багатослівний
--замовив
(у майбутньому дозволить повне упорядковане відповідність)
-u, -- небезпечно
дозволяє видалити всі показання в когорті, навіть останнє
-s, --розділи
кількість або діапазони розділів для запуску; за замовчуванням для всіх розділів
--правила
кількість або діапазони правил для виконання; за замовчуванням для всіх правил
--правило ім'я або номер окремого правила для виконання
-d, --відлагоджувати
вмикає вихід налагодження (дуже шумний)
-v, -багатослівний
збільшує багатослівність
-2, --vislcg-compat
вмикає режим сумісності для старих граматик CG-2 і vislcg
-I, --stdin
файл для читання введених даних замість stdin
-O, --stdout
файл для друку замість стандартного виведення
-E, --stderr
файл для друку помилок замість stderr
-C, --codepage-all
кодова сторінка для використання для граматичних, вхідних і вихідних потоків; за замовчуванням – UTF-8
--граматика кодової сторінки
кодова сторінка для граматики; перевизначає --codepage-all
--кодова сторінка-введення
кодова сторінка для введення; перевизначає --codepage-all
--кодова сторінка-виведення
кодова сторінка для виведення та помилок; перевизначає --codepage-all
-L, --locale-all
локаль для використання для граматичних, вхідних та вихідних потоків; за замовчуванням en_US_POSIX
-- мова-граматика
локаль для використання для граматики; перевизначає --locale-all
--locale-input
локаль для введення; перевизначає --locale-all
--locale-вивід
локаль для використання для виведення та помилок; перевизначає --locale-all
--без відображень
вимикає всі правила MAP, ADD і REPLACE
--без виправлень
вимикає всі правила SUBSTITUTE і APPEND
--no-before-секції
вимикає всі правила в частинах BEFORE-SECTIONS
--без розділів
вимикає всі правила в частинах SECTION
--не-після розділів
вимикає всі правила в частинах AFTER-SECTIONS
-t, --слід
друкує вихідні дані налагодження разом із звичайним виводом
--тільки ім'я траси
якщо правило названо, опустіть номер рядка; має на увазі --слід
--trace-no-remored
не друкує зняті показання; має на увазі --слід
--trace-encl
сліди, за якими в даний момент відбувається проходження огорожі; має на увазі --слід
--сушить
не вносити фактичних змін до введення
--однопробіг
запускає кожну секцію лише один раз; такий же, як --максимальний пробіг 1
--максимальний пробіг
запускає кожну секцію максимум N разів; за замовчуванням необмежено (0)
-S, --статистика
збирає статистику профілювання під час застосування граматики
-Z, --оптимізувати-небезпечно
деструктивно оптимізувати профільовану граматику, щоб бути швидшим
-z, --оптимізувати-безпечно
консервативно оптимізувати профільовану граматику, щоб бути швидшим
-p, --префікс
встановлює префікс відображення; за замовчуванням @
--unicode-теги
виводить кодові точки Unicode для таких речей, як ->
--unique-tags
виводить унікальні теги лише один раз за читання
--кількість вікон
кількість вікон для збереження в буферах до/попереду; за замовчуванням 2
--завжди-span
змушує тести сканування завжди охоплювати межі вікна
--м’який ліміт
кількість когорт, після яких вмикаються М’ЯКІ-РІЗНИКИ; за замовчуванням 300
-- жорстка межа
кількість когорт, після яких вікно примусово вирізається; за замовчуванням 500
-D, --dep-розмежування
розмежувати вікна на основі залежності замість DELIMITERS; за замовчуванням 10
--dep-оригінал
виводить вихідний тег залежності вхідних даних, навіть якщо він більше не дійсний
--dep-allow-loops
дозволяє створювати кругові залежності
--dep-no-crossing
запобігає створенню залежностей, які призводять до перетину гілок
--не магічні читання
запобігає запуску правил на магічні читання
-o, --no-pass-source
запобігає проходженню тестів сканування точки відправлення
-e, --show-end-tags
дозволяє тегам <<< відображатися у виводі
--show-unused-sets
друкує список невикористаних наборів та їх номери рядків; має на увазі --лише граматика
--show-tag-heshes
друкує список тегів та їх хешів, коли вони аналізуються під час виконання
--show-set-hashes
друкує список наборів та їх хешів; має на увазі --лише граматика
Використовуйте cg3 онлайн за допомогою служб onworks.net